Actions to Implement Immediately Following an Incident

When a mishap occurs, individuals must respond quickly to preserve their health and legal rights. First, making sure of personal safety is paramount; if possible, relocating to a safe spot away from traffic is essential. Next, calling emergency services for medical assistance and police support is critical, as this record can serve as essential evidence later.

Obtaining data is another necessary step; parties should exchange contact and insurance details with other involved persons and write down witness information if accessible. Taking photos of the accident scene, vehicle damage, and any visible injuries helps to further back up claims.

In conclusion, avoiding conversations regarding fault or liability at the scene is wise, as this may obstruct subsequent court cases. Following these prompt actions can greatly impact the conclusion of any potential claims or legal actions, ensuring that people are able to manage the aftermath effectively.

What to Anticipate in the Court System?

What measures should one anticipate when traversing the legal process after a personal injury? First, the injured party will gather documentation, including health documents and accident reports, to establish the case's foundation. Next, they will meet with a personal injury lawyer, who will provide guidance on rights under law and possible damages.

After this, the attorney will lodge a formal claim with the insurance provider, launching talks. If a satisfactory resolution is not obtained, the case may enter legal proceedings, where both parties submit their arguments in court.

Throughout this procedure, the injured person should be prepared to participate in discovery, which entails exchanging information and evidence between parties. Additionally, depositions may occur, allowing both parties to question testimony providers. In the end, the legal process can be long and intricate, but comprehending these phases can reduce stress and worry and guarantee that the individual is prepared for what lies in the future.

Transparent Fee Structure

Grasping the pricing model is essential when selecting a personal injury lawyer. Clear fee disclosure helps clients understand their options, minimizing the risk of surprise expenses. Many injury attorneys operate on a contingency arrangement, indicating they only get paid if the client prevails in the case. This arrangement aligns the lawyer's associated resource interests with those of the client, promoting a collaborative approach. However, clients should inquire about extra costs, such as court fees or expert witness costs, which may not be included in the contingency fee. A lawyer who offers a clear explanation of their fee structure fosters trust and ensures that clients are fully aware of their financial obligations throughout the case proceedings. This transparency can significantly impact the overall client experience.

What is the Average Cost of Hiring a Personal Injury Attorney?

Hiring a personal injury lawyer typically runs between 33% to 40% of the settlement. Many lawyers operate on a contingency fee arrangement, indicating they only get paid if the plaintiff wins the case.

Can I Still Receive Damages if I Was Partially at Fault?

Yes, people can still claim compensation even if somewhat at fault. However, the amount of compensation may be decreased based on the level of responsibility attributed to them in the accident. Professional legal advice is recommended.

Which Sorts of Accidents Are Qualified for Personal Injury Claims?

Countless accidents warrant personal injury claims, featuring car collisions, slip and fall falls, employment-related injuries, medical malpractice, and product liability cases. Each situation necessitates specific evidence to establish the claim for monetary relief.

What Timeframe Applies to Filing a Personal Injury Claim?

Generally, a person has two to three years to submit a personal injury lawsuit, according to state laws. Quick action is important, as evidence can diminish and deadlines may vary based on particular circumstances.

Will my dispute proceed to trial or settle out of court?

The determination of a case depends on various circumstances. Many injury cases settle outside court, but some end up in court if discussions fail or if the disputants cannot accept settlement figures.
